TheWkly Analysis

Carter Camacho, a man from Georgia, was arrested while running towards the US Capitol building. He was reportedly wearing a tactical vest and gloves at the time of his arrest. The incident raised immediate security concerns given the Capitol's history of being a target for violent acts. Law enforcement responded quickly to the situation to ensure the safety of the area. This event underscores ongoing tensions surrounding security at significant national landmarks.
